Transaction d5c64bc21db2bef4dffbf7aa82e76a0cf2dae2fdb235f121ebe911a16cb7be2b
1 Input
1 Output
-
d5c64bc21db2bef4dffbf7aa82e76a0cf2dae2fdb235f121ebe911a16cb7be2b:0
- value
- 32519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f89062cf5346f86d5e9517e23fc4c988ea9b79b5 OP_EQUAL
- address
- 3QMJUEMy6bLx17eRFpihCqcrCTWSeRSDLw